No, there is no direct train from Laxenburg to Sankt Pölten. However, there are services departing from Laxenburg-Biedermannsdorf and arriving at St.Poelten Hbf via Wien Hbf.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 55 min.
The distance between Laxenburg and Sankt Pölten is 81 km. The road distance is 71.4 km.
